New York Birth Injury Lawsuits

The birth process can be a risky moment for both mother and baby. Although advances in medicine have made the process safer, the doctors and nurses involved must still uphold the highest standards of professional practice.

A lawyer experienced in the field of birth injury law will scrutinize medical records, consult experts and fight to secure the compensation you deserve to prove your case. A successful claim can cover all of your expenses including future and past.

Duty of Care

The birth of a child could be one of the most exciting experiences a family will ever be able to experience. However, that event can be stressful if medical mistakes during the birth, labor and delivery cause injuries to the infant. In New York, healthcare providers are legally bound to treat patients with the highest standards of medical care. If doctors and other healthcare professionals fail to adhere to this standard, it might be possible to start a lawsuit for birth injury attorneys injuries to recover damages for a victim's loss.

It is crucial to establish that the defendant was bound by a duty of good care to the plaintiff in order to prevail on the claim. This can be accomplished by proving the existence of a doctor-patient relationship and setting up a standard for medical care appropriate to a health provider in the circumstances. This is usually done by medical documents and expert witness testimony.

If a healthcare professional breaches the duty of care, then the victim has to prove that the breach directly caused the injury. The accident would not have occurred in the event that the breach had not occurred. The plaintiff must also prove that they sustained damages. The victim needs to show that he or she was a victim of damages.

Medical experts are often involved in a birth injury claim. They can estimate the cost of care a victim may need over their life. These costs can be astronomical and are a vital element of the success of a claim.

Breach of Duty

The degree to which a healthcare provider owes you the duty of care is contingent on the circumstances. It also depends upon the medical community's norms and practices in similar situations. This is why the involvement of medical experts might be necessary to establish the appropriate standard in the circumstances of your case.

To be successful in your case, you need to show that the defendant violated this duty by failing to follow medically-accepted practices. An experienced lawyer will know the best way to gather and present evidence in the courtroom. Your lawyer will also be familiar with the defenses offered by the defendants or their insurers in these cases.

It is also necessary to prove that the breach of this duty resulted in the birth injury of your child. This is a difficult part of the case to prove since it requires you to argue that your child would not have suffered injuries but because of the negligence or carelessness of the defendant. This is why it is essential to have an experienced New York birth injury lawyer on your side. An experienced lawyer will know what evidence to look for and how you can prove that your child's injury was preventable. They will also be able prove the full extent of the losses your child has suffered to ensure that you receive the full amount of compensation you are entitled to.

Causation

Birth injuries can be devastating for parents and children alike. In addition to the emotional trauma it also incurs financial costs for medical and treatment. This could include hospitalization, surgery, physical therapy, medication, and home health aides. In certain instances, these costs may also extend into adulthood.

It is crucial to prove that a medical professional owed you a duty of care and that they breached this duty. This is proving that the doctor-patient relationship was in place and that they failed to offer the level of skill and care that is expected in their specialty under similar circumstances. The plaintiff must also prove that the breach was the cause of the injury.

Proving the medical malpractice case is complicated and varies in each state. It is important that you choose an attorney with experience in the legal jurisdiction where you live.

The first step is to schedule an appointment for a no-cost consultation. During this consultation, an attorney will evaluate whether your claim has merit and will review possible legal strategies. They will also go over the options available to you for pursuing damages for injuries to your child. The attorney typically begins the legal process by filing an Summons and Complaint. Then, they will engage in a period of discovery, which involves the exchange of evidence as well as information between both sides of the lawsuit.

Damages

In a lot of cases, complicated calculations are involved in calculating damages. Serious injuries can lead to costs for life-long care that are in the millions. This could include 24-hour home medical and nursing care, physical and occupational therapy or other treatment that is specialized. It is difficult to determine the monetary value of such needs without consulting experts.

In order to win the case the plaintiff must prove that the defendant violated their duty to care. This requires establishing an appropriate standard of care. The standard is usually determined by the medical professions' own customs and practice in similar situations. An experienced attorney will speak with medical experts who will examine the evidence and testify about the ways in which the doctor or the hospital did not meet the standard.

If the expert agrees with an alleged breach of duty the next step is to establish causation. This involves linking the breach of duty to the harm sustained by the mother or infant. To do this, Birth Injury Lawsuits the attorney will send a request package with records and documentation to the malpractice insurer of the hospital or doctor. The package should contain the documentation and documents which show how the lapse occurred.
